Frequently Asked Questions about Valverde

How much are Studio apartments in Valverde?

There are currently 606 Studio Apartments in Valverde with rent ranges from $789 to $4,475 with an average price of $1,570.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Valverde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Valverde ranges from $733 to $11,067 with an average monthly rent of $2,150.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Valverde c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Valverde range from $880 to $14,982.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,099.

How expensive are Valverde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 126 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Valverde on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,150 to $13,729 - averaging $3,657 for the location.
